Lower Egypt is one of the six regions of Egypt. This region is the capital of the nation.
Location
Lower Egypt is neighbored by the following regions:
- Greece, Aegean Islands
- Turkey, Crete
- Turkey, Mediterranean Coast of Turkey
- Egypt, Middle Egypt
- Egypt, Red Sea Coast
- Egypt, Sinai
- Cyprus, Southern Cyprus
- Poland, Western Desert
